Magnolia × 'Yellow Bird'
Magnolia × 'Yellow Bird' is a striking hybrid magnolia, notable for its late blooming, butter-yellow, green-tinged, upright tulip-shaped flowers that emerge after the foliage, better protecting them from spring frosts. Its elegant pyramidal habit, exceptional floriferousness, and good hardiness make it a remarkable choice as a specimen accent tree, in a free-standing hedge, or integrated into an ornamental bed. It adapts well to fertile, slightly acidic, well-drained soils and prefers a sunny to semi-shaded exposure, sheltered from dry winds. Its moderate growth, compact and upright structure, and luminous floral color give 'Yellow Bird' a strong and lasting visual impact in Quebec gardens looking for an original, hardy, and low-maintenance magnolia.
